========================================================================== Ubuntu Security Notice USN-3496-2 November 28, 2017 python2.7 vulnerability ========================================================================== A security issue affects these releases of Ubuntu and its derivatives: - Ubuntu 12.04 ESM Summary: Python could be made to run arbitrary code. Software Description: - python2.7: An interactive high-level object-oriented language Details: USN-3496-1 fixed a vulnerability in Python. This update provides the corresponding update for Ubuntu 12.04 ESM. Original advisory details:  It was discovered that Python incorrectly handled decoding certain  strings. An attacker could possibly use this issue to execute arbitrary code. Update instructions: The problem can be corrected by updating your system to the following package versions: Ubuntu 12.04 ESM:   python2.7                       2.7.3-0ubuntu3.10   python2.7-minimal               2.7.3-0ubuntu3.10 In general, a standard system update will make all the necessary changes.
